Community Comes Together to Help Man Find His Stolen Ford Truck
A community came together and helped the owner of this Ford truck find his stolen ride.
Banding Together
For those of us who love our Ford trucks, there's nothing worse than the possibility of losing that beloved possession - whether it be to theft or an accident. Thus, we can only imagine how the owner of this vintage 1970s Ford pickup felt when it was stolen from the Kamloops Golf & Country Club in British Columbia, Canada some time ago. Luckily for him, however, the community banded together and helped return that pickup to its rightful owner, according to InfoTel News.

Call for Help
The owner of the vintage pickup was out playing golf at that club, but when he finished up and headed to the parking lot, he discovered that it was gone - stolen in pure daylight in the middle of the afternoon. This prompted his step-daughter - Jami-Lynn Delorme - to post pictures of the pickup on Facebook, asking the community to help locate it.

Tracking Them Down
Amazingly, it didn't take long for the community to come through on that request, too. In fact, several people responded to the call for help and noted they had seen the truck around town, which enabled police to track it down and recover it. A resident of Cache Creek - which is around 50 miles away - contacted Delorme to let her know that the thieves had stopped on her property, trying to steal gas to fill its tank, in fact.

Good Outcome
Police wound up finding the thieves and the truck near the Historic Hat Creek Ranch, and perhaps more amazingly, the vintage Ford pickup was in good condition when it was recovered, too.

Group Effort
“It’s his baby,” Delorme said of her stepfather's truck. “He doesn’t drive it in the winter. I’m just really thankful. I’m grateful to everybody who had their eyes out, grateful my stepdad got it back. We don’t even live right in town but everyone came together for us.”
